After my 600 mile service the fuel pipe was getting crushed on to the rear cylinder head nuts. Check that its routed around the nuts not over them. This lead to fuel starvation on mine, noticable as a flat spots on accelleration. Though if you can smell fuel it sounds like its not firing or too rich. is the choke cable routing ok (not on permanently)

My coils went after 300 miles so it is possible!Secondly if you've had the tank off I hope you've reseated the tank correctly and got the fuel lines back into the reservoir under the tank, as one issue is the fuel lines press on top of the rear coil and vibration can cause an issue...
